Compared with LIXI, LIR is more effective in improving blood glucose and reducing weight, and both treatments are well tolerated (75, 77, 78)

However, when combined with insulin or sulfonylureas, hypoglycemia risk increases, and dose adjustments of these concomitant medications may be necessary
